Location: Cheshire

Salary: Up to £55,000 basic + bonuses

Setting: 4‑bed Children’s Residential Home (currently 1 young person)

Contract: Full‑time, Permanent

We are looking for an ambitious and values‑driven Registered Manager to lead a 4‑bed children’s home supporting young people with Emotional and Behavioural Difficulties (EBD). This is a brilliant opportunity for:

  • An aspiring Deputy Manager who knows their worth
  • An outstanding Senior ready to take the next step

The home is currently settled with one young person, offering the incoming Manager the chance to embed strong practice, shape the culture, and grow the service the right way.

What You’ll Need

  • Registered Manager
  • Minimum 2 years’ experience in a leadership role within children’s residential care
  • Confidence implementing structure, routines, and development within a home
  • A strong understanding of safeguarding, compliance, and Ofsted expectations
  • Full UK driving licence
  • Enhanced DBS suitable for working with children
  • Level 5 in Leadership & Management or willingness to enrol

What’s on Offer

  • Base salary: £55,000
  • Up to £10,000 in annual bonuses
  • If working towards: Fully funded Level 5 Diploma (Leadership & Management)
  • Consistent support from an experienced Senior Leadership Team with extensive experience in residential care

CureYourSearch is dedicated to ensuring the safety and welfare of vulnerable individuals, therefore all offers of employment are subject to a DBS check.
